bey

/bey/US // beɪ //UK // (beɪ) //

蓓依,蓓伊,蓓蓓,蓓蕾

Definitions

n.名词 noun
  1. 1

    plural beys.

    • : a provincial governor in the Ottoman Empire.
    • : a title of respect for Turkish dignitaries.
    • : the title of the native ruler of Tunis or Tunisia.
